The XC6127C55A7R-G is an ultra-small voltage detector designed for high precision and low power consumption. It features a built-in delay circuit with release delay times that can be set between 50ms and 800ms, and includes a manual reset function that allows for reset assertion at any time. The device operates within a voltage range of 0.7V to 6.0V and can detect voltages from 1.5V to 5.5V in 0.1V increments. This product is available in both CMOS and N-channel open drain output configurations, with output logic options of active low (RESETB) and active high (RESET). The XC6127C55A7R-G is suitable for applications such as microprocessor logic reset circuitry, system battery life monitoring, memory battery backup circuits, power-on reset circuits, and power failure detection. Its compact USPN-4 package is ideal for portable devices and high-density mounting applications, while also being compliant with EU RoHS standards.
